Job Summary: As a Building Automation Programmer, you will leverage your mastery of Schneider Electric EBO to design, program, and commission building automation systems for HVAC, lighting, and other integrated systems. You’ll play a critical role in creating customized, user-friendly solutions that meet client specifications while maximizing operational efficiency. Key Responsibilities: Programming & Development: Create and modify sequences of operation, logic, graphics, and dashboards within Schneider Electric EBO platforms to meet project requirements. System Integration: Integrate third-party devices and systems into Schneider Electric EBO, ensuring seamless interoperability and performance. Project Collaboration: Work closely with project managers, engineers, and field technicians to ensure the successful implementation of building automation systems. Commissioning & Testing: Perform on-site commissioning, troubleshooting, and testing to verify system performance and ensure adherence to design specifications. Client Support: Provide technical support and training to clients on system operation, programming modifications, and troubleshooting. Documentation: Maintain detailed records of programming, system configurations, and as-built documentation for all projects. Innovation: Stay up-to-date with the latest Schneider Electric EBO software releases, tools, and best practices to continuously improve programming capabilities. Qualifications: Proven expertise in Schneider Electric EcoStruxure Building Operation (EBO), including programming, configuration, and commissioning. Strong understanding of HVAC control systems, protocols (BACnet, Modbus, etc.), and building automation system architecture. Ability to read and interpret mechanical, electrical, and control drawings and specifications. Experience with integration of third-party devices and equipment into BAS platforms. Position Highlights: Position: Medical Laboratory Scientist (MLS) - Microbiology Location: Evanston Hospital Full Time/Part Time: Part time, 20 hours Hours: Monday-Friday, 7am –3:30pm, e/o weekend and rotating holidays What you will do: Under general supervision and according to established policies and procedures, performs various clinical microbiology tests in one or more sections of the laboratory to obtain data for use in diagnosis and treatment of disease. Ensures the accuracy and precision of diagnostic results through performance of maintenance and calibration of multiplex instrumentation systems. Routinely resolves technical and interdepartmental problems related to the various laboratory areas. Readily identify problems that may adversely affect performance or reporting of results and taking corrective action or notifying supervising personnel when appropriate. Demonstrate ability to work cooperatively with others. Good communication and organizational skills. What you will need: Education: Bachelor’s or Associate’s degree in a laboratory science or medical technology and/or the required courses to meet CLIA requirements for moderate to high complexity testing. Certification: MT or MLS (ASCP) preferred Experience: Experience preferred Unique or Preferred Skills: Able to solve technical and interdepartmental problems related to the various Laboratory areas with assistance and under supervision. Capable of identifying problems that may adversely affect test performance or reporting of results and taking corrective action or notifying appropriate supervisory personnel to assist with taking corrective action.
